Salmonella Newport Bacterial Extract became the first federally licensed vaccine using SRP® Technology in November, 2004. This vaccine is exclusively marketed and distributed in the US by AgriLabs through a nationwide network of AgriLabs member distributors. The current USDA license is conditional, and at this time sales are limited to licensed veterinarians only.


INDICATIONS: For use in healthy cattle six months of age or older as an aid in the control of disease and fecal shedding caused by infection with Salmonella Newport.

COMPOSITION: This vaccine contains a bacterial extract derived from S. Newport, comprised of purified Siderophore Receptor and Porin (SRP®) proteins, in an oil-based adjuvant. Contains formaldehyde and polymyxin-B as preservatives.

DIRECTIONS: Shake well before use. Administer 2 mL (1 dose) subcutaneously ahead of the shoulder. Revaccinate in 2 to 4 weeks. Dry cows and bred heifers should be vaccinated twice before calving; whole herd vaccination may be done at any stage of lactation as an aid to control salmonellosis. Revaccinate annually.

CAUTION: Store at 35° to 45° F (2° to 7°C). DO NOT FREEZE. Use entire contents when first opened. Do not vaccinate within 60 days of slaughter. Transient swelling may occur at the injection site. In the case of anaphylactoid reactions, administer epinephrine immediately. Contains an emulsified adjuvant; in case of self injection, seek immediate medical attention. The product license is conditional. Efficacy and potency test studies in progress.
